What CSIA certification absolutely covers
CSIA stands for the Chimney Safety Institute of America, a nonprofit that trains and certifies pros in chimney inspection, cleaning, and restore. Earning the credential requires passing proctored assessments on codes, creation, venting physics, fuels, and safety practices. To stay licensed, technicians need to recertify each and every three years, because of this ongoing coaching and facts they're current on adjustments to NFPA 211, neighborhood codes, and most well known practices.
This isn't always tutorial minutiae. Misdiagnosing a smoke chamber trouble can ship fumes desirable returned into dwelling areas. A poorly seated liner can trigger carbon monoxide leakage right into a wall hollow space. And a overlooked crown crack can soak a masonry stack all wintry weather, most advantageous to spalling brick with the aid of spring. A CSIA qualified technician is trained to attach indications to root motives, not simply wipe away soot and movement on.
In Minneapolis, that awareness intersects with reality everyday. Wind-driven snow can pressure moisture below flashing that might sit down tight in calmer climates. Masonry chimneys over unconditioned garages see extra freeze-thaw stress than the ones contained in the thermal envelope. Even gasoline home equipment venting into outsized flues can build up acidic condensate that eats mortar joints. CSIA coursework addresses those genuine situations.
The actual negative aspects in the back of a grimy or damaged chimney
People almost always suppose chimney functions start up and stop with soot removing. If all you burn is a few bundles of save-offered hardwood on weekends, you possibly can skate by for a season or two. But combustion is chemistry, and each burn leaves a signature. Softwoods and unseasoned timber produce extra creosote, a tar-like substance which may ignite at round 1,000 degrees Fahrenheit. A chimney hearth does not politely announce itself. It roars like a freight teach, often cracked tiles flying out the peak, different occasions smoldering quietly and generating hairline fractures that turn out to be your main issue months later.
Gas home equipment raise alternative disadvantages. They burn purifier, but scale down flue temperatures can lead to condensation in outsized masonry stacks. That moisture picks up acidic byproducts and assaults mortar joints. Over time, you get flue gasoline leakage into the brickwork. The chimney nonetheless appears “nice” from the open air, at the least except a part of liner shifts or the face bricks start to flake.
Then there may be carbon monoxide, which will become a risk when draft is compromised by means of a blockage, a beaten liner, an improperly sized flue, or competing power in a tight house. I have considered a homeowner tape close a mechanical room louver to “stop drafts,” in simple terms to starve a boiler of combustion air and send CO to come back up the return ducts. A qualified tech anticipates these interactions and exams the puzzle as an entire.
What a skilled chimney provider actual includes
When owners search “chimney services and products close to me,” they might discover a long list of supplies, from chimney inspection to chimney restoration and hearth cleansing. The high-quality big difference exhibits up in how the service is added. A relevant seek advice from in Minneapolis often runs during this order: deploy indoors renovation, examine roof get admission to given latest weather, assessment the external stack for crown, cap, and flashing disorders, then scope the flue from prime or backside. Only after inspection deserve to cleansing start out, no longer the alternative approach round. That sequence issues for the reason that cleaning a broken flue can make difficulties worse if unfastened tiles or failed mortar are already reward.
Creosote removal shouldn't be one-length-matches-all. Stage 1 fluffy soot brushes out unquestionably. Stage 2 flake or glaze may additionally require specialized rotary methods. Stage 3 glazed creosote, the glassy, hardened layer, mainly needs chemical medicine, mechanical removal, or maybe partial relining if this will no longer liberate effectively. A CSIA qualified professional is aware of when to forestall and re-evaluate rather then forcing a instrument that might damage a tile.
Fireplace cleansing is a component cleansing, component inspection. A soot-stained fireplace seems ordinary to tidy, however the precise fee is the inspect the smoke chamber, damper condition, and lintel integrity. If a tech pauses to measure the throat opening or asks approximately smoke roll on windy nights, take that as a terrific sign. It way they are interested by air stream, now not simply polish.
Chimney cap setting up and chimney relining require judgment and fingers that have executed the work. A cap should be sized to the flue, screened for spark arrestor purpose, and fixed properly satisfactory to ride out a February ice storm. A liner must suit the appliance category and BTU input, and be insulated or no longer centered on code and clearances. Over the years I even have observed the whole lot from aluminum dryer vent crammed down a hearth flue, to a stainless liner left uninsulated in an outdoors chimney that by no means reached right kind draft.
Why certification topics exceptionally in Minneapolis
Our winters create stress assessments. The freeze-thaw cycle the following can repeat dozens of instances in a unmarried season. Water will get into hairline cracks in the crown or mortar joints, freezes, expands, then thaws. Each cycle widens the distance. A chimney that looks strong in October can drop a brick face with the aid of March if the crown is not very sealed efficiently or the cap is missing.
Wind is a different factor. Open components across the lakes or alongside the river channel gust challenging. A marginal cap will rattle unfastened or deform, and any open high invites animals. More than once I have pulled a soggy squirrel nest the dimensions of a basketball out of a flue in April. That is an apparent blockage. Less seen are partial obstructions that slow draft, that can turn a smoke-unfastened hearth right into a room-filling haze on a still night time.
Building inventory topics too. Minneapolis has a mix of early 1900s brick homes, mid-century ranches, and more moderen infill. Older chimneys were most often developed for coal or low-efficiency wood stoves, then repurposed for fuel appliances a long time later. Many lack clay tile liners in solid structure, and some have offset flues that complicate relining. Certified chimney sweeps are educated to identify these age-targeted considerations and suggest suggestions that meet the two code and the individual of the apartment.

Seasonal timing and frequency in Minneapolis
People ceaselessly ask how almost always they must schedule a chimney sweep Minneapolis appointment. The straightforward solution relies upon on use and gas. For timber-burning fireplaces or stoves, the NFPA training is annual inspection and cleansing as mandatory. If you burn two or three cords each one winter, plan on cleaning mid-season and returned on the quit, principally if the primary part of the season used marginally professional wood. If you burn much less, an annual inspection with cleaning in basic terms if deposits are offer would possibly suffice.
For gas-fired appliances venting into masonry, look at every year and plan for liner contrast each and every few years. Gas does no longer build creosote, yet it should boost up mortar decay. Older clay tile liners quite often need a stainless insert with insulation to stabilize draft and shelter the masonry in our local weather.
Timing matters. If that you could, agenda chimney inspection in late summer or early fall. Crews are less slammed, you preclude remaining-minute backlogs, and any chimney repair can cure true earlier freeze. If you leap your first fireplace and odor a pointy, acrid scent upstairs, that could be a hint you will have damaging power pulling flue odors into the residence. Call early. Do not wait till the vacations.
Common issues I see in Minneapolis properties, and what solves them
Chimneys tell experiences. The soot styles, the cracks, the means a damper sits, even the paint discoloration on a chase cowl, all aspect toward intent and impact.
Smoke spillage on beginning-up in a basement fire is widely wide-spread here. The stack and flue are chilly, the basement is reasonably depressurized by using bog followers or a outfits dryer, and smoke takes the straightforward path into the room. A professional tech will pre-hot the flue with a rolled newspaper torch, verify make-up air, and advocate a appropriate-sealing damper or insulated liner to preserve warm greater among burns.
Moisture staining on a ceiling close to the chimney in March in the main strains returned to crown failure or missing counterflashing. Rebuilding the crown with a suited overhang and drip edge, then surroundings new counterflashing into the mortar joints, stops the cycle. A chimney cap is non-negotiable. In this weather it ought to be stainless or heavy-gauge galvanized with a stable lid and mesh sized to deter pests.
Persistent soot odor on humid days in summer time aspects to creosote inside the smoke chamber and flue, mixed with humidity drawing scent out. Cleaning by myself may possibly assist, yet sealing a parged smoke chamber, bettering excellent-quit air flow with a correct sized cap, and making certain the damper seals thoroughly will mostly clear up it.
Clay tile flues with offset joints that experience cracked resulting from thermal surprise are an even bigger repair. The expert solution is a stainless steel liner sized to the appliance, occasionally with poured or blanket insulation. It is simply not the most inexpensive line item on the idea, yet it restores structural integrity and improves draft. Done by way of certified chimney sweeps, chimney relining offers you predictable overall performance and compliance with code.
What a radical inspection record needs to include
Documentation is component to the job. After a suited chimney inspection, anticipate a document that notes flue circumstance by way of area, damper variety and position, smoke chamber conclude, firebox situation, lintel integrity, crown fabric and cracks, cap condition, and flashing fame. For real property transactions, a point 2 inspection with a video scan and still snap shots should always be prevalent. Recommendations ought to separate protection-quintessential presents like breached flue tiles from repairs pieces like minor mortar joint touch-u.s.a.
Measurements count number. If anybody is proposing a chimney cap setting up, they need to present dimensions and fabric spec. If recommending chimney relining, they have to provide an explanation for how they sized the lining to the equipment or fire establishing, and even if they plan to insulate. If you might have a wooden range insert, the lining should always prolong to the higher of the chimney, not prevent on the smoke shelf, and the encompass may want to be sealed.

How much should it cost to sweep a chimney?
A chimney sweep typically costs $150 to $350 for a standard cleaning and Level 1 inspection, but prices vary significantly based on chimney type (gas is cheaper, wood-burning costs more) and creosote buildup, potentially ranging from $80 for a gas fireplace to over $400 for complex jobs or severe buildup requiring more extensive work, with annual maintenance often cheaper than first-time or neglected cleanings.
What's the average price to have your chimney cleaned?
The average cost to clean a chimney is typically $150 to $300 for a standard cleaning and inspection, but prices can range from $100 to over $400 depending on the chimney type, level of creosote buildup (heavy buildup costs more), location, and if extra services like camera inspections are included. Basic cleanings for gas or prefabricated chimneys might be cheaper ($80-$175), while wood-burning masonry chimneys with heavy buildup cost more ($200-$380+).
